Is Hopelawn a good place to live?
Hopelawn offers a comfortable, affordable lifestyle with a median home value of approximately $280,171 and a median household income of $68,663, making it attractive for families and professionals. The low unemployment rate of 0.7% indicates a stable local economy, and the community features accessible amenities, parks, and schools. While it is a small community, residents appreciate its quiet atmosphere and proximity to larger cities for work and entertainment. The poverty rate of 8.1% is relatively low, suggesting most residents have access to essential services and opportunities. Overall, Hopelawn is considered a good place to live for those seeking a peaceful, family-friendly environment with a strong sense of community.
